Though it's smack in the middle of Santa Cruz, this B&B has lush gardens, a running stream, and tall trees that make you feel like you're in a secluded wood. All rooms have fireplaces (though a few are electric) and featherbeds; most have private patios. Complimentary wine, cheese, and fresh-baked cookies are available in the afternoon. Pros: Close to UCSC, walking distance from downtown shops, woodsy feel. Cons: Near a high school, some rooms are close to a busy street.
